系统: ubuntu20.04
场景 轻量监控docker 容器 ---> eg : per 5min 执行一次,内存利用率大于95% ,发出提示
脚本1:筛选内存使用率大于80%的容器
简洁版本:
sudo docker stats --no-stream --format "table {{.Container}}\t{{.Name}}\t{{.CPUPerc}}\t{{.MemPerc}}\t{{.MemUsage}}" | awk 'NR==1 || $4+0 > 80'

系统: ubuntu20.04
场景 轻量监控docker 容器 ---> eg : per 5min 执行一次,内存利用率大于95% ,发出提示
脚本1:筛选内存使用率大于80%的容器
简洁版本:
sudo docker stats --no-stream --format "table {{.Container}}\t{{.Name}}\t{{.CPUPerc}}\t{{.MemPerc}}\t{{.MemUsage}}" | awk 'NR==1 || $4+0 > 80'
